Job Description

We are seeking a team-orientated and highly skilled general urologist to provide locum coverage in Regina, Saskatchewan. This position has the potential to transition into a permanent full-time role.

Remuneration is competitive for this locum and is based on a daily rate of $2,417.00. The Saskatchewan Health Authority (SHA) will cover the cost of flights, car rental and temporary accommodations.

The SHA is seeking a team-orientated and highly skilled urologist to join its Department of Surgery, Division of Urology in Regina, Saskatchewan, to provide locum coverage in Regina, Saskatchewan. This position has the potential to transition into a permanent full-time role.

Operating Room (OR) and procedural time (eg. cystoscopy, ambulatory care, etc.) would be available depending on patient needs and the duration of the locum. OR access for urgent or emergent clinical conditions would be available per our after hours OR usage rules. The program is complimented with a high-quality anesthesiology program and a day surgery unit which has extended hours for patient recovery. The arriving specialist would share in a minimum of a 1 in 5 call rotation.

The successful candidate will be expected to demonstrate experience and training in Urology, appropriate for an academic tertiary care level referral centre. The candidate will be expected to show evidence of interpersonal and collaborative skills with initiatives to further advance the clinical and academic productivity of the SHA. Commitment and demonstrated interest in research and surgical education at all levels are expected.

Call coverage is a requirement for the position. In addition to a daily rate in an alternate payment arrangement, you would be eligible for any on-call retainer consistent with the Specialist Emergency Coverage Program.

Specialty Type: Specialist - Urological Surgeon

Qualifications:

The ideal candidate will hold certification or be eligible for certification from the Royal College of Physicians and Surgeons of Canada in Urology.

This individual should be a team player, be able to interact effectively with patients, colleagues, staff and management, and function well in a high-volume environment with a commitment to the provision of high-quality patient and family-centered care.

Candidates must be eligible for provisional or regular licensure through the College of Physicians and Surgeons of Saskatchewan.
